titleOfInvention |
System for predicting ventricular tachycardia |
abstract |
A system for predicting ventricular tachycardia from eletrocardiographic input waveforms, comprising filter means, including a high pass filter, for generating an output in response to said input waveforms, characterised by level means to which said input waveforms are supplied and operating to provide an output representative of said input waveforms exceeding a preselected level, the output of said level means being used to control the gain of said filter means. |
